Output 85db7d5851901dc0af2fb607fee80239852be36ec30e393bbeac0754aee8a5a9:17

value
387592855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1824aa428bb596497097c107f466949166d679e OP_EQUALVERIFY OP_CHECKSIG
address
1P1yw3nGNfroMXV942F9VaQv26GvRk2ee9
transaction
85db7d5851901dc0af2fb607fee80239852be36ec30e393bbeac0754aee8a5a9
confirmations
553482
spent
true